Which of the following amino acid contains free sulphydryl group -
High-Yield Explanation
Ans. is 'a' i.e., Cysteine o There are two sulfur containing amino acids :-i) Cysteineii) Methionineo The side chain of cysteine contains sulfhydryl group that has a pKa of approximately 8.4 for dissociation of its hydrogen sulfhydryl groups of two cystein molecules can form covalent disulfide bond to form cystineo Methionine although it contains sulfur group, does not containt sulfhydryl group and cannot form disulfide bond.
